This book comprehensively discusses nature-inspired algorithms, deep learning methods, applications of mathematical programming and artificial intelligence techniques. It will further cover important topic such as linking green supply chain management practices with competitiveness, industry 4.0, and social responsibility.
This book:
- Addresses solving practical problems such as supply chain management, take-off, and healthcare analytics using intelligent computing
- Presents a comparative analysis of machine learning algorithms for power consumption prediction
- Discusses a machine learning-based multi-objective optimization technique for load balancing in an integrated fog cloud environment
- Illustrates a data-driven optimization concept for modeling environmental and economic sustainability
- Explains the use of heuristics and metaheuristics in supply chain networks and the use of fuzzy optimization in sustainable development goals
The text is primarily written for graduate students, and academic researchers in diverse fields including electrical engineering, electronics and communications engineering, mathematics and statistics, computer science and engineering.
